U.S. Bancorp to Present at the RBC Capital Markets Financial Institutions Conference

U.S. Bancorp (NYSE: USB) announced today that Terry Dolan, vice chairman of wealth management and securities services, is scheduled to participate in a discussion regarding the Company at the RBC Capital Markets Financial Institutions Conference. The session will begin at 8:00 a.m. EDT on Wednesday, March 11, 2015 in New York City. The discussion will include information about U.S. Bancorp's financial performance and corporate strategies.

Minneapolis-based U.S. Bancorp (“USB”), with $403 billion in assets as of December 31, 2014, is the parent company of U.S. Bank National Association, the 5th largest commercial bank in the United States. The company operates 3,176 banking offices in 25 states and 5,022 ATMs and provides a comprehensive line of banking, brokerage, insurance, investment, mortgage, trust and payment services products to consumers, businesses and institutions.
